What companies run services between Abbots Langley, England and Twickenham, England?

You can take a train from Kings Langley to Twickenham via London Euston, Euston station, Waterloo Station, and London Waterloo in around 1h 13m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Summerhouse Way to Heath Road / Grove Avenue via Watford Junction station, Heathrow Terminal 2, Heathrow Terminals 2 & 3 station, Hatton Cross station, and Hatton Cross Station in around 2h 13m.
